Abstract
East Kalimantan is ranked 2nd highest in breast cancer in Indonesia. One of the cancer treatments is chemotherapy. Chemotherapy causes effects such as nausea and vomiting and hematological toxicity. Nausea and vomiting are the main factors causing weight loss, and hematological toxicity is the main factor causing hypoalbuminemia. This study aims to determine the relationship between chemotherapy frequency and albumin levels and weight loss in breast cancer patients. The research was conducted in September 2023. There were 33 respondents. The instruments used are digital scales and medical records. Data analysis used the chi-square test (α<0.050). The results of the study showed that there was no relationship between the frequency of chemotherapy and albumin levels (p=0.084) and there was a relationship between the frequency of chemotherapy and weight loss (p=0.030) with a fairly strong relationship (r=0.441).
